The skin is the body's largest organ
What is the body's largest organ?
The bones in your spine are call this
What are vertebrae?
"Cardio-" refers to this part of the body.
What is the heart?
This joint in the human body is the largest
What is the knee?
This muscle is responsible for pumping blood throughout the body.
What is the heart?
The right side of the heart pumps blood to this organ
What are the lungs?
The suffix "-itis" means this
What is inflammation?
These blood cells help your body fight infections
What are white blood cells?
Red blood cells, White blood cells, and platelets.
What makes up blood?
This lobe of the brain is primarily responsible for vision.
What is the occipital lobe?
"Hematology" is the study of this
What is blood?
This organ can regenerate itself if part of it is removed
What is the liver?
